IS 10262 is required for mix design in civil engineering.
IS 10262 is the code for concrete mix design in India.
It provides guidelines for proportioning of concrete ingredients based on strength and durability requirements.
The code covers various aspects such as water-cement ratio, workability, and compressive strength.
Mix design is crucial for ensuring the desired properties and performance of concrete.

Dynamic method considers time history of earthquake while equivalent static method simplifies earthquake forces into equivalent static forces.
Dynamic method analyzes building response to actual time history of earthquake ground motion.
Equivalent static method simplifies earthquake forces into equivalent static forces based on simplified assumptions.

Berthing of a vessel refers to the process of docking or mooring a ship at a pier or quay.
Factors affecting berthing include wind speed and direction, current, tide, visibility, size and maneuverability of the vessel, availability of tugs or mooring lines, and the condition of the berth.
